Eastern Germany Wildfires Injure Firefighters, Force Large Evacuations
Severe wildfires have been raging in eastern Germany, particularly in the Gohrischheide region on the border of Saxony and Brandenburg, where the fire has spread to an estimated 1000 hectares and caused mass evacuations. The fires are especially difficult to control due to the terrain being a former military training ground with unexploded ammunition, forcing firefighters to maintain a safe distance and complicating suppression efforts. Nearly 500 firefighters are involved in battling the blaze, which has seriously injured two firefighters and prompted emergency declarations in multiple districts. Evacuations have affected villages such as Heidehauser, Neudorf, and parts of Lichtensee, with residents receiving mobile alerts advising them to take essentials and use improvised respiratory protection. The fire threatens a large nature reserve home to rare animals and plants, and authorities have deployed a state police helicopter equipped with special cameras to detect embers and monitor the fire’s progression. Officials have urged travelers to avoid the region as the situation remains extremely dangerous and the fire continues to spread due to strong winds and dry vegetation.
